Artemis II Launch Marks Historic Return to Crewed Moon Missions

In a significant milestone for space exploration, NASA’s Artemis II mission successfully launched from Florida, marking the first crewed Moon mission in half a century. The mission, which faced numerous delays and technical challenges, represents a pivotal moment in the United States’ commitment to returning humans to the lunar surface and beyond.

Launch Details

The Artemis II spacecraft lifted off from the Kennedy Space Center, igniting a new chapter in lunar exploration. The mission is part of NASA’s broader Artemis program, which aims to establish a sustainable human presence on the Moon by the end of the decade. The spacecraft is now in Earth’s orbit, preparing for its journey towards the Moon, where it will orbit before returning to Earth.

The crew aboard Artemis II includes a diverse team of astronauts, each selected for their unique expertise and experience in spaceflight. Their mission will not only test the spacecraft’s systems but also gather valuable data that will inform future lunar landings, including Artemis III, which is slated to land astronauts on the Moon.

Significance of the Mission

The Artemis program is not only a return to the Moon but also a stepping stone for future exploration of Mars and beyond. By establishing a sustainable presence on the Moon, NASA aims to develop technologies and strategies that will be crucial for human missions to Mars in the 2030s.

Artemis II will serve as a critical test of the Orion spacecraft’s life support systems and other essential technologies needed for long-duration spaceflight. The data collected during this mission will help refine the processes and equipment required for future missions, ensuring that astronauts can safely explore the lunar surface and beyond.
